Evaluation of Inhaled Colistimethate Sodium in Adult Bronchiectasis Patients with Asymptomatic Pseudomonas aeruginosa Infection: A Randomized Controlled Trial

Objectives
The primary objective of this study is to evaluate the effect of **ColiFin®** therapy compared to standard of care (SOC) on achieving sputum/airway culture negativity for **Pseudomonas aeruginosa** (PA) 28 weeks after randomization in patients with bronchiectasis. This is clinically relevant as achieving culture negativity may indicate successful eradication of the infection, potentially leading to improved patient outcomes and reduced disease progression.
Secondary objectives include evaluating the effect of ColiFin® therapy compared to SOC on various clinical parameters over a 28-week period:
- Change in PA bacterial density in sputum.
- Frequency of mild to moderate pulmonary exacerbations requiring antibiotic treatment.
- Frequency of severe exacerbations leading to hospitalizations.
- Time to first pulmonary exacerbation requiring antibiotic treatment.
- Quality of life (QoL) measured by the St. George’s Respiratory Questionnaire (SGRQ).
- Respiratory Symptom Score (RSS) measured by the Quality of Life Questionnaire Bronchiectasis (QoL-B).
- Overall QoL measured by the QoL-B.
- Change in percent predicted forced expiratory volume in one second (ppFEV1).
- Change in antibiotic susceptibility in isolated sputum PA.
- Safety of ColiFin® therapy during the study.

Treatment
The clinical trial involves the use of **ColiFin®**, an experimental medication formulated as a **nebuliser solution**. The active substance in ColiFin® is **colistimethate sodium**, classified under the pharmacotherapeutic group of other antibacterial agents, specifically polymyxins, with the ATC code J01XB01. The medication is provided as a powder for the preparation of a solution intended for inhalation use. The maximum daily dose is 4 million international units (IU), with a total maximum dose of 112 million IU over the treatment period. The treatment is administered via inhalation, and the maximum treatment period is 28 days. The product is manufactured by PARI PHARMA GMBH and is not a paediatric formulation.

Inclusion and Exclusion Criteria
Inclusion Criteria
- Age ≥ 18 years at screening
- Bronchiectasis verified by chest CT scan
- New positive sputum culture for PA (not older than 12 weeks at screening)
- No recent onset of new respiratory symptoms or worsening of pre-existing respiratory symptoms (e.g. cough, sputum amount, sputum colour, sputum viscosity, haemoptysis, decreased exercise capacity, malaise, fatigue etc.) over the last 2 months before new positive PA sputum culture, as per investigator judgement
- Written informed consent
- Negative serum/urine pregnancy test in women of childbearing potential (WOCBP) at screening
- WOCBP must agree to maintain a highly effective method of contraception during study treatment and at least 4 weeks thereafter
- Male subjects have to use condom during treatment and until the end of relevant systemic exposure in the male subject, plus a further 90-day period and non-pregnant WOCBP partner have to use any contraception method additionally
Exclusion Criteria
- Bronchiectasis due to cystic fibrosis
- Known prior infection with PA in the past 5 years before the new positive PA culture
- Treatment with pseudomonas-active antibiotics in the period between new PA positive sputum culture and baseline visit
- Planned pseudomonas-active antibiotic treatment during the time of study participation
- Any treatment with inhaled antibiotics or long-term pseudomonas-active treatment (≥3 months) in the past 5 years before screening
- Known intolerance to ColiFin® in prior medical history
- Hypersensitivity/Known intolerance to Colistimethate sodium, Colistin, polymyxin B or to other polymyxins
- Known diagnosis of myasthenia gravis or porphyria
- ppFEV1 < 30% (post-bronchodilator)
- Pregnant women
- Breast feeding women
- strongly impaired renal function, GFR ≤ 30 ml/min
- Participation in any other interventional clinical trial
